Gilles Tapolsky, Ph.D.
Cheif Scientific Officer
Dr. Tapolsky brings over 20 years of experience in corporate management,
research and pharmaceutical development to ACT. In this newly created
position, he will be responsible for the leadership of all pre-clinical
and clinical development activities.
Prior to joining ACT, Dr. Tapolsky served as Vice President,
Product Development at Tapestry Pharmaceuticals of Boulder,
Colorado. In this position, he led the development of new
anti-cancer agents, designing and implementing pre-clinical
studies of multiple compounds.
He was also
a member of the clinical development group and supported
all clinical studies. Previously, Dr. Tapolsky was Vice
President, Research & Development
at FeRx Incorporated where he was responsible for building
that company’s
drug discovery efforts and evaluating business development
opportunities. He was awarded several NIH grants to further
explore the use of the MTC
technology for the targeted delivery of anti-cancer agents.
Earlier in his career, Dr. Tapolsky was Director, Product
Development at ViroTex
where he conceived and developed the BEMA® and MCA® technologies.
Further development of these technologies resulted in the
successful development of several products, as well as
the implementation of a number of corporate
collaborations. Before joining ViroTex, Dr. Tapolsky held
several senior Research and Development positions at Flamel
Technologies, in Lyon, France,
that he helped co-found. He started his career as a research
scientist in the materials science department of Rhone-Poulenc
Rhorer where he contributed
to the design, synthesis and characterization of novel
products. Dr. Tapolsky holds a Ph.D. in Chemistry for the
University of Paris as well as an MBA
from Rice University in Houston. |
